Alrighty, you go to your Paypal History, on the far lefthand side click "Download History". This takes you to a page where you can choose which dates and type of transactions to download.... then a few minutes later you will get an email saying your log is available for download.... when you have downloaded your log, open the Excel file... highlight the column that contains the email addresses and copy and paste them into notepad. Only problem with this if you have had a transaction with the same person more than once, their email address is duplicated.... not sure if outlook or outlook express pick this up when you send the emails and rectifies it OR the same person will get 2 or more emails from you, haven't got that far yet... will try it out
